1. Fishing and Boating in Matagorda Bay

Approximate distance from the Port Lavaca KOA: 20–30 minutes

Matagorda Bay is one of the best fishing spots on the Texas coast. Whether you prefer casting a line from the shore, heading out in a kayak, or booking a guided fishing trip, the opportunities are endless. Anglers will find redfish, speckled trout, and flounder throughout the bay. Beyond fishing, the calm waters are perfect for paddling or enjoying a sunset boat cruise.

Things to do:

  • Fishing from the shore, pier, or boat
  • Kayaking and exploring the bay’s quiet inlets
  • Evening boating or sunset cruises

2. Explore Matagorda Island State Park

Approximate distance from the Port Lavaca KOA: 1.5-hour drive plus ferry or boat ride

For a more remote adventure, take a trip to Matagorda Island State Park. Accessible only by boat or ferry, this undeveloped barrier island offers pristine beaches, hiking trails, and incredible birding opportunities. It’s an excellent destination for anyone wanting to get away from the crowds and immerse themselves in nature.

Things to do:

  • Hike along scenic island trails
  • Fish from the shore or by boat
  • Birdwatch for shorebirds, waterfowl, and raptors
  • Beachcombing and seashell hunting
  • Primitive camping or day trips

3. Visit the Matagorda County Museum

Approximate distance from the Port Lavaca KOA: 1 hour

Located in Bay City, the Matagorda County Museum highlights the area’s rich history, from early settlements to maritime culture. Exhibits include artifacts, regional history displays, and stories of Native American heritage. It’s a great stop for families or anyone interested in learning more about the roots of the Matagorda Bay region.

Things to do:

  • Explore local history and maritime exhibits
  • Learn about early settlements and Native American culture
  • View artifacts from the Texas coast

4. Birdwatching at Matagorda Bay Nature Park

Approximate distance from the Port Lavaca KOA: 25–35 minutes

Matagorda Bay Nature Park is a haven for birdwatchers and nature enthusiasts. With its prime location along migratory flyways, the park offers excellent opportunities to spot herons, egrets, pelicans, and many other species, especially during spring and fall migrations. The park also features walking trails and open spaces for a peaceful day outdoors.

Things to do:

  • Birdwatching along designated viewing areas
  • Nature walks and photography
  • Picnicking with family and friends

5. Relax on Matagorda Bay Beaches

Approximate distance from the Port Lavaca KOA: 30 minutes to 1 hour

For a quiet and less crowded beach experience, Matagorda Bay has several hidden gems. Magnolia Beach is a favorite for locals, while stretches along Matagorda Island provide more remote escapes. These beaches are perfect for swimming, fishing, shell hunting, or simply relaxing in the Texas sun.

Things to do:

  • Walk or lounge along peaceful beaches
  • Shore fishing or kayaking
  • Collect seashells and explore tide lines
  • Build sandcastles and enjoy family time

6. Take a Scenic Drive Along the Matagorda Peninsula

Approximate distance from the Port Lavaca KOA: 20–30 minutes

The Matagorda Peninsula offers one of the most beautiful drives along the Texas coast, with water views on both sides. The route showcases coastal marshes, open bay waters, and access points to fishing areas and wildlife viewing spots.

Things to do:

  • Enjoy scenic coastal views
  • Stop at picnic areas or wildlife refuges
  • Visit fishing piers or marinas along the way

7. Explore the Matagorda Ship Channel

Approximate distance from the Port Lavaca KOA: about 1 hour

The Matagorda Ship Channel connects Matagorda Bay to the Gulf of America and is an impressive site for both history and industry enthusiasts. Large cargo ships, recreational boats, and fishing opportunities make this area worth exploring.

Things to do:

  • Watch ships pass through the channel
  • Fish from nearby piers and jetties
  • Spot local wildlife, including shorebirds and dolphins
